Cheapest Available Chico and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ments

As of March 26, 2025 the lowest priced 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Chico, TX is the 3br duplex Model starting from $839 at Country Club Estates in the Downtown Mineral Wells neighborhood. The second most affordable Chico 3 Bedroom is the 3 Bedroom Model at Crestwood Apartments starting at $1,400 in the North Fort Worth neighborhood. The average price for all 3 Bedroom apartments in Chico is currently $2,423.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 3 Bedroom options in Chico:

Getting Around Chico, TX

Walk Score®

12 / 100

Car-Dependent

Almost all errands require a car

Bike Score®

30 / 100

Somewhat Bikeable

Minimal bike infrastructure
